Homemade Artisan Bread

Cultural Context

Artisan bread has roots in European baking traditions, where local bakers would craft loaves using simple ingredients and traditional methods. This bread is celebrated for its crusty exterior and chewy texture, often baked in a wood-fired oven. Today, it has gained popularity worldwide, with home bakers embracing the art of bread-making, resulting in countless variations and flavors.

1

Whisk together the dry ingredients: bread flour, instant yeast, and salt.

2

Use room temperature or cool water to activate the yeast, as cooler water helps develop flavor.

3

Fold the ingredients together with a spatula or a wooden spoon until combined.

4

If the dough seems dry and shaggy, continue working it with your hands until it comes together.

5

Cover the dough tightly and let it rise at room temperature for 2 to 3 hours until it doubles in size.

6

For best flavor, refrigerate the dough for at least 12 hours and up to 3 days after the initial rise.

7

Flour a baking sheet generously or use cornmeal to prevent sticking.

8

Flour the work surface and gently pour the sticky dough onto it.

9

Shape the dough into one round loaf or two longer loaves, being careful not to overwork it.

10

Transfer the shaped loaves to the floured baking sheet and cover them to rest for 45 minutes at room temperature.

11

Preheat the oven to 475°F (246°C).

12

Score the tops of the loaves with shallow cuts for steam release.

13

Optionally, pour boiling water into a metal or cast iron pan on the bottom rack for a crispier crust.

14

Place the baking sheet with the loaves on the middle rack and bake for 20 to 25 minutes until golden brown.

15

Check for doneness by tapping the loaves; they should sound hollow, or check the internal temperature, which should be 195°F (91°C).

16

Let the bread set for 20 minutes before slicing.
